/** * {@inheritDoc} */ @Override public void removeSelectionInterval(Date startDate, Date endDate) { Contract.asNotNull(startDate, "date must not be null"); if (isSelectionEmpty()) return; if (isSelectionInInterval(startDate, endDate)) { selectedDates.clear(); fireValueChanged(EventType.DATES_REMOVED); } }
/** * {@inheritDoc} */ @Override public void removeSelectionInterval(Date startDate, Date endDate) { Contract.asNotNull(startDate, "date must not be null"); if (isSelectionEmpty()) return; if (isSelectionInInterval(startDate, endDate)) { selectedDates.clear(); fireValueChanged(EventType.DATES_REMOVED); } }
/** * {@inheritDoc} */ @Override public void removeSelectionInterval(Date startDate, Date endDate) { Contract.asNotNull(startDate, "date must not be null"); if (isSelectionEmpty()) return; if (isSelectionInInterval(startDate, endDate)) { selectedDates.clear(); fireValueChanged(EventType.DATES_REMOVED); } }
/** * {@inheritDoc} */ public void removeSelectionInterval(Date startDate, Date endDate) { Contract.asNotNull(startDate, "date must not be null"); if (isSelectionEmpty()) return; if (isSelectionInInterval(startDate, endDate)) { selectedDates.clear(); fireValueChanged(EventType.DATES_REMOVED); } }
/** * {@inheritDoc} */ @Override public void removeSelectionInterval(Date startDate, Date endDate) { Contract.asNotNull(startDate, "date must not be null"); if (isSelectionEmpty()) return; if (isSelectionInInterval(startDate, endDate)) { selectedDates.clear(); fireValueChanged(EventType.DATES_REMOVED); } }